What can I see and do near Ryozen Kannon War Memorial?
You might want to spend some time browsing the exhibits at Kyoto National Museum, National Museum of Modern Art, Kyoto or Kyoto Municipal Museum of Art. Sights like Kodai-ji Temple, Three-Year Slope and Yasaka Shrine are landmarks to visit in the area. You can watch performances at Gion Corner, Kyoto MINAMIZA Theatre and Kyoto Kaikan Concert Hall if you're interested in local theatre.
How can I get to Ryozen Kannon War Memorial?
With so many ways to get around, seeing the area around Ryozen Kannon War Memorial is easy. You can take advantage of metro transport at Higashiyama Station, Sanjo Keihan Station and Keage Station. If you're taking a train into town, Gion-shijo Station, Kiyomizu-gojo Station and Sanjo Station are the closest stations to Higashiyama Ward.
